2026-05-29 02:20:09
想要打造区块链交易平台APP,第一步应该怎么做
前言:为什么要关注区块链交易平台APP开发?
区块链技术现在可是个热门话题,大家都在聊。你可能听说过比特币、以太坊,但你知道背后支撑这些虚拟货币的是什么吗?没错,就是区块链!现在很多企业都在考虑要不要开发一个区块链交易平台APP。话说回来,这开发流程到底是个怎么回事呢?
假设有一天,你决定响应这一趋势,开发一个属于自己的区块链交易平台APP。那么,第一步该做什么呢?
第一步:明确你的目标和需求
在动手之前,我们得先想清楚自己的目标。你是想服务普通用户,通过这个平台方便他们交易数字货币吗?还是想为企业提供专业的交易解决方案?目标不一样,开发的方向和需求就完全不一样。
比如说,我认识一个朋友,他想开发一个投资人专用的交易平台,主要面向大额交易用户。那他就得考虑到很多安全性和效率方面的问题。而如果你做的是面向大众的简单APP,那可能功能性就相对简单一些。
第二步:市场调研
接下来是市场调研。这步真的很重要,别小看了它。有很多新手一头热就开始开发,其实不查询市面上现有的产品,最后的结果可能会让你心碎。
你可以开始追踪一下其他成功的区块链交易平台,比如说Coinbase、Binance这些。看看他们的用户界面(UI),功能设计,甚至用户评论。搞清楚什么是用户需要的、什么是你可以改进的,这样你的APP才能做得更好。
我记得我当时也做了市场调研,花了好几周时间,看了各种平台的界面和功能。最后我意识到,很多用户希望有更加直观的操作界面,那么,我就决定重点在这方面下功夫。
第三步:选择技术栈
技术栈是什么呢?简单来说,就是你开发这个APP所需要的各种技术和工具。你知道,开发区块链APP跟一般的APP可不是一个概念,不过选对了技术栈,事情就容易多了。
一般来说,搭建区块链交易平台,你可能会用到的技术有:
- 区块链开发框架(如Ethereum, Hyperledger等)
- 数据库技术(如MongoDB, PostgreSQL)
- 前端框架(如React, Angular)
- 后端技术(如Node.js, Python等)
当然,这也只是我个人的一些建议。总之,选一个合适自己团队能够掌握的技术栈是非常重要的,这样才能保证开发的顺利进行。
第四步:制定详细的开发计划
有了目标、技术栈和市场调研的数据后,我们需要制定详细的开发计划。这个计划就像是你旅途中的导航图,指引着你一步步朝着目标前进。
你需要划分开发阶段,包括:
1. 原型设计:把你的想法画出来。
2. MVP(最小可行产品)开发:先做出基本功能的APP,主要就是为了测试市场的反应。
3. 测试:检查问题并做出改进。
4. 正式上线:把APP发布到各大应用市场。
在这一步,记得设置一些里程碑,例如完成原型设计的时间、MVP的上线时间,这样有了日程的约束感,才能更有效率。
第五步:开发过程
这时候就进入真正的开发阶段了,实打实要动手做了。团队中的程序员们开始编写代码,设计师们为APP的视觉效果加油助力。
在开发过程中,有几个关键点你一定要注意:
- **安全性**:区块链交易平台涉及资金安全,得特别小心。确保你的平台拥有强大的加密技术和安全机制。
- **用户体验**:界面要友好,操作要简单。用户一进去能立刻明白怎么用,不然一看就头大可不行。
- **测试反馈**:在开发的过程中,记得经常做测试,听取一线用户的反馈。这样能及时发现问题,保证APP的质量。
曾经我看到一个平台,为了快速上线,忽视了安全性,结果上线后没多久就遭到了黑客攻击,损失惨重。可见,这个环节绝不能马虎。
第六步:上线和推广
终于,开发完毕,APP要上线了!这时候可别太紧张,这是一个新的开始。
上线后,最重要的事情之一就是推广。没有用户,那你的APP就相当于一朵孤独的花儿,开得再美也是没人欣赏。
你可以通过各种渠道去宣传,比如社交媒体、线上广告、区块链社区等等。试试做一些活动,比如“下载APP送代币”,这样的促销方式也是能吸引一部分用户的。
另外,让你认识的项目方合作,给他们一些 incentives(奖励)去推广你的平台,也许会获得意想不到的效果。
第七步:持续与维护
上线后的工作可没有结束,反而是新生活的开始。你需要定期更新你的APP,修复用户反馈的问题,增加新功能,用户体验。
在这个过程中,保持与用户的沟通也很重要。你可以开一个社群,定期发布更新,还可以收集他们的建议。毕竟,用户的声音才是最重要的嘛!
如果能在用户群中保持良好的互动,用户粘性自然会提高,大家愿意一直使用你的平台。
总结
开发一个区块链交易平台APP的过程,听上去似乎很复杂,其实每一步都有其独特的乐趣和挑战。从最初的构思到最后的上线,每个环节都能让你收获不少。希望通过以上的分享,能对你有所帮助!如果决定开始这个旅程,祝你好运哦!